North Stephentown is a hamlet in Town of Stephentown, Rensselaer, New York. North Stephentown is situated nearby to the hamlet Cherryplain, as well as near Stephentown Center.- Type: Hamlet

Cherry Plain, also spelled Cherryplain, is a hamlet in eastern Rensselaer County, New York, United States. It comprises the ZIP code of 12040. It is located east of Troy, New York, in the town of Berlin, New York. Cherryplain is situated 2½ miles north of North Stephentown.

Hancock is a town of 700 people in Massachusetts in the Berkshire region. Its two most notable attractions are Jiminy Peak ski resort and the historic site of Hancock Shaker Village.
